Arlington National Cemetery at Christmas

arlington-national-cemetery.jpgWreath Laying at Arlington National Cemetery

Morrill Worcester, President of Worchester Wreaths started the tradition of laying wreaths on the graves of our veterans at Arlington in 1992 and in 2007 founded Wreaths Across America to carry the tradition to military cemeteries … More things you should do’…

Rocky Knob Cabins

Within minutes of Mabry Mill, one of the Blue Ridge Parkway’s most popular attractions, spend the night at the historic Rocky Knob Cabins located at Milepost 174. These historic, rustic cabins are tucked in a secluded glade along the Parkway.
